Taj rated as World’s Strongest Hotel Brand

According to the report release by Brand Finance, Taj secures a BSI (Brand Strength Index) score of 89.3 out of 100 and a corresponding elite AAA brand strength rating based on factors such as customer familiarity, employee satisfaction, corporate reputation and customer service.

Taj emerges the strongest hotel brand in the world in ‘Hotels 50 2021’ report released by Brand Finance. This report recognises the most valuable and strongest hotel brands across the globe.

Puneet Chhatwal, Managing Director & Chief Executive Officer, Indian Hotels Company said, “This is a proud moment for the Indian hospitality industry on the global stage. Taj being rated as the World’s Strongest Hotel Brand is a testament to the unwavering trust our guests have consistently placed in us and the warmth and sincere care our employees have embodied day-after-day. We will continue our endeavor to elevate the world class experiences of luxury hospitality and deliver the magic of Tajness to all our stakeholders.” 

David Haigh, CEO, Brand Finance said, “We are excited to announce Taj as the Strongest Hotel Brand in the World. A brand with a century old legacy and a custodian of the revered Indian hospitality has stood resilient in spite of the challenges posed by the ongoing pandemic. Global travelers have relied upon and tested brands in different ways and Taj has emerged on top.”

Taj received an overall Brand Strength Index of 89.3 out of 100, with a corresponding AAA rating for customer familiarity, employee satisfaction, corporate reputation and customer service.

The Hotel 50 2021 report also highlighted the company’s successful implementation of its R.E.S.E.T 2020 strategy, which provided a transformative framework, helping the Taj brand surmount pandemic related challenges.
